Transaction 51d5a2860bd87871cfaaaa5ef104923937ca9ccdf78e802e0dadfa3200af33bd
1 Input
2 Outputs
- 51d5a2860bd87871cfaaaa5ef104923937ca9ccdf78e802e0dadfa3200af33bd:0
- 51d5a2860bd87871cfaaaa5ef104923937ca9ccdf78e802e0dadfa3200af33bd:1
value 4960
address 146pHxLr9sbiUKwi9wTi9ctsgbxGJyhbGX
value 683520
address 1KXp2PDvnS4HnvzvB7jz5jr1hbfLT9Dc6m